From 246354f8e2eb829013a540a34604297e250c8101 Mon Sep 17 00:00:00 2001 From: Alexander Martinz Date: Wed, 30 Jan 2019 23:29:21 +0100 Subject: [PATCH] Eleven: remove guava dependency Pulling in guava just for an annotation, which is available in the support library as well is a bad idea. Change-Id: I0e02943616c41077071e4ccba9125c73fb574d3b Signed-off-by: Alexander Martinz --- Android.mk | 3 +-- src/org/lineageos/eleven/locale/LocaleSet.java | 2 +- src/org/lineageos/eleven/locale/LocaleSetManager.java | 2 +- src/org/lineageos/eleven/locale/LocaleUtils.java | 3 +-- 4 files changed, 4 insertions(+), 6 deletions(-) diff --git a/Android.mk b/Android.mk index 391067b..2a3ec5d 100644 --- a/Android.mk +++ b/Android.mk @@ -10,8 +10,7 @@ LOCAL_RESOURCE_DIR := $(addprefix $(LOCAL_PATH)/, res) LOCAL_STATIC_JAVA_LIBRARIES := \ android-support-v8-renderscript \ - android-common \ - guava + android-common LOCAL_STATIC_ANDROID_LIBRARIES := \ android-support-v4 \ diff --git a/src/org/lineageos/eleven/locale/LocaleSet.java b/src/org/lineageos/eleven/locale/LocaleSet.java index 59949ac..0b0f3b0 100644 --- a/src/org/lineageos/eleven/locale/LocaleSet.java +++ b/src/org/lineageos/eleven/locale/LocaleSet.java @@ -16,8 +16,8 @@ package org.lineageos.eleven.locale; +import android.support.annotation.VisibleForTesting; import android.text.TextUtils; -import com.google.common.annotations.VisibleForTesting; import java.util.Locale; public class LocaleSet { diff --git a/src/org/lineageos/eleven/locale/LocaleSetManager.java b/src/org/lineageos/eleven/locale/LocaleSetManager.java index de245f6..6e49f9e 100644 --- a/src/org/lineageos/eleven/locale/LocaleSetManager.java +++ b/src/org/lineageos/eleven/locale/LocaleSetManager.java @@ -17,11 +17,11 @@ package org.lineageos.eleven.locale; import android.content.Context; +import android.support.annotation.VisibleForTesting; import android.text.TextUtils; import android.util.Log; import org.lineageos.eleven.provider.PropertiesStore; -import com.google.common.annotations.VisibleForTesting; import java.util.Locale; diff --git a/src/org/lineageos/eleven/locale/LocaleUtils.java b/src/org/lineageos/eleven/locale/LocaleUtils.java index 40af650..8f91639 100644 --- a/src/org/lineageos/eleven/locale/LocaleUtils.java +++ b/src/org/lineageos/eleven/locale/LocaleUtils.java @@ -18,13 +18,12 @@ package org.lineageos.eleven.locale; import android.provider.ContactsContract.FullNameStyle; import android.provider.ContactsContract.PhoneticNameStyle; +import android.support.annotation.VisibleForTesting; import android.text.TextUtils; import android.util.Log; import org.lineageos.eleven.locale.HanziToPinyin.Token; -import com.google.common.annotations.VisibleForTesting; - import java.lang.Character.UnicodeBlock; import java.util.ArrayList; import java.util.Collections; -- 2.11.0